Runbook: ReplicaWatch lag alarm for the Ostrand cluster. Alarm fires when replica lag exceeds 30s for 5 minutes. First check: long-running analytics queries on the replica; kill any over 10 minutes. Second: verify WAL shipping throughput. Do not promote the replica without sign-off. Reviewer note: any change to these thresholds requires a load-test artifact attached to the PR. Reference the build token printed immediately below when approving.

build token for kagaf-hahof: htk14_9d3d4d26d7d8de

## Releases

Heads up: the Burrowlink resolver sometimes flakes during release pushes — you'll see timeouts against the internal registry, then a retry magically works. It's DNS caching weirdness on the Tanglewood edge nodes, not your build. If a customer reports a failed update, just have them retry after a minute. When cutting a release manually, you'll need to sign the bundle with the deploy key below.

deploy key for kajof-fajop: bky6_gDHw9Q

# Quick note for this week's sync: the Grovetail report builder
# relies on stable sorts when grouping rows by region, then by
# channel. Our old comparator wasn't stable, so ties flipped
# between runs and QA kept filing "flaky export" bugs. We now
# force a tiebreak on row ingest order. Don't "optimize" that
# away, please. The tiebreak depth and batch sizes below were
# tuned against the Pellworth dataset. The constants follow.

tuning table, yajog-yahof:
BUDGETS = {
    "lamvan": 303,
    "wenox": 460,
    "fenvan": 525,
}